Kazakhstan loses last game at 2014 IIHF Championship in Minsk

ASTANA. KAZINFORM - Kazakhstan's national team was outplayed by Finland 3:4 during the ice hockey world championship in Minsk on 19 May, Kazinform refers to Vesti.kz.

The game vs Finland was the last one for Kazakhstan at this year's championship. Goals: 0:1 - Palola (07:53, Lehtera, Komarov), 1:1 - Rymarev (14:32, Polishuk, Krasnoslobodtsev), 2:1 - Polishuk (15:51, Rymarev, Krasnoslobodtsev), 2:2 - Lehtera (19:18, Karalahti), 2:3 - Jokinen (27:24, Kontiola, Mantyla), 2:4 - Immonen (39:57, Jokinen, Jormakka), 3:4 - Romanov (59:31, Zhailauov). Kazakhstan's team earned only two points at the 2014 IIHF World Ice Hockey Championship and is placed the last in Group B.
